Transaction 2459e593e2c2e85bf517b37a896daf42b449077f676044615d5e3ff1df721978

1 Input
1 Outputs
  • 2459e593e2c2e85bf517b37a896daf42b449077f676044615d5e3ff1df721978:0
  • value  1334303
    address  3Di4QYH6tQuN43Fba58AhsTbquWNV5aYxq